During MPLS LDP GR, a GR helper takes the lesser one between its LDP neighbor liveness time and 
the GR restarter’s FT reconnect time as its FT reconnect interval, and takes the lesser one between its 
LDP recovery time and that of the GR restarter as its LDP recovery interval. 
 
Restarting MPLS LDP Gracefully 
To test MPLS LDP GR without main/backup switchover, you can restart MPLS LDP gracefully. You are 
not recommended to perform this operation in normal cases. 
Follow these steps to restart MPLS LDP gracefully:

Configuring BFD for MPLS LDP 
Bidirectional forwarding detection (BFD) provides a mechanism to quickly detect and monitor the 
connectivity of links in networks. MPLS LDP can use it to detect neighbor failures. After a failure is 
detected, the MPLS forwarding plane can switch the service from the active path to a standby path. You 
need to configure MPLS-related functions before enabling BFD for MPLS LDP.
